Crypto Security Improves An InDepth Look at the Decline in Hacks and Rug Pulls in 2024

Cryptocurrency investors, developers, and stakeholders continue to prioritize security in the rapidly changing world of digital currencies. Recent data reveals a promising trend in crypto security, with a significant 20% reduction in losses from hacks and rug pulls in 2024 compared to the previous year. This article aims to explore this development by examining significant incidents, targeted networks, and the changing landscape of blockchain security.

Analyzing the Data: Decrease in Crypto Losses
According to a comprehensive report by Immunefi, losses from hacks and rug pulls decreased by 20% in 2024 compared to the previous year. The report highlights that the crypto community faced over $473.22 million in losses across 108 incidents until May 2024, marking a notable improvement from the $595.43 million reported during the same period in 2023.

Breaking down the data further, May 2024 witnessed $52.37 million lost through 21 distinct incidents, representing a 12% decrease from May 2023. This downward trend is particularly noteworthy considering the 28% drop from April 2024’s $72.60 million in losses.

Key Incidents: Gala Games and Sonne Finance
Examining notable incidents in May 2024 sheds light on the evolving tactics employed by malicious actors in the crypto space. One such incident involved Gala Games, a crypto gaming project, which fell victim to a severe breach on May 20. A flaw in the platform’s smart contract was exploited by a hacker, resulting in the creation of 5 billion GALA tokens. The hacker then converted 592 million GALA tokens into approximately $21.8 million worth of Ethereum (ETH).

Prompt action from the Gala Games team, including blacklisting the hacker’s address and collaboration with law enforcement, helped recover the stolen funds and prevent further unauthorized transactions. The team’s swift response demonstrates the importance of proactive measures in mitigating the impact of security breaches in the crypto space.

Similarly, Sonne Finance, a decentralized liquidity market protocol, experienced a substantial cyber attack on May 15. Initially, the theft involved $3 million from its USD Coin and Wrapped Ethereum contracts on the Optimism chain. However, within just 30 minutes, the situation escalated, and losses soared to an alarming $20 million.

Dec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ms bore the brunt of these exploits in May, while centralized finance (CeFi) platforms remained relatively unscathed. These incidents underscore the need for robust security measures and continuous monitoring to protect users and assets in the ever-evolving crypto landscape.

Analysis of Loss Distribution: Hacks vs. Rug Pulls
A closer examination of the loss distribution reveals that hacks were the predominant cause of crypto losses in May 2024, accounting for $50.61 million across 14 incidents. In contrast, rug pull events accounted for $1.75 million across seven incidents, representing a mere 3.3% of the total losses.

This analysis highlights the evolving tactics employed by malicious actors, with hacks remaining a prevalent threat in the crypto space. Rug pulls, while less common, can still have significant repercussions for users and projects alike. As such, maintaining vigilance and implementing robust security protocols are essential to mitigate these risks.

Targeted Networks: Ethereum and BNB Chain
Examining the targeted networks provides valuable insights into the strategies adopted by malicious actors in the crypto space. In May 2024, Ethereum and BNB Chain emerged as the most targeted networks, accounting for 62% of the total losses.

Specifically, Ethereum experienced nine incidents, contributing to 43% of the total losses across all chains. BNB Chain, on the other hand, encountered four incidents, constituting 19% of the overall losses. These findings underscore the importance of strengthening security measures on these networks to protect users and assets from potential threats.
